[chef] Re: Re: chef-server runit failing on Ubuntu


Chronological Thread 
  • From: Haselwanter Edmund < >
  • To:
  • Subject: [chef] Re: Re: chef-server runit failing on Ubuntu
  • Date: Sat, 28 May 2011 11:14:40 +0200


On 28.05.2011, at 00:57, 
< >
 
< >
 wrote:

> Figured it out:
> 
> The call to "exec /usr/bin/env chef-server" in the /etc/sv/chef-server/run
> script fails because the chef-server exec isn't on the path. Adding
> /opt/ruby/bin to PATH solves the problem. Same holds for
> /etc/sv/chef-server-webui/run. So either the run script is wrong or else the
> exes didn't get put in the right place.

I think this is again an issue with rubygems. The bin path of the rubygems is 
a moving target.
On the last lucid32 Vagrant instance rubygems 1.7 is installed which has 
/opt/ruby/bin as bin path.

the wget rubygems 1.3.7 install has /usr/bin as path

the path in runit recipes (e.g. god) expects /usr/bin

very annoying

cu edi 

--
DI Edmund Haselwanter, 
,
 http://edmund.haselwanter.com/
http://www.iteh.at ;| http://facebook.com/iTeh.solutions ;| 
http://at.linkedin.com/in/haselwanteredmund ;








Archive powered by MHonArc 2.6.16.

§